...be careful in messing with the ROM. See this (http://www.pdastreet.com/forums/showthread.php?s=&threadid=20987&highlight=JackFlash) thread and this (http://www.pdastreet.com/forums/showthread.php?s=&threadid=24195&highlight=JackFlash) one.
The US T|T's don't have much ROM at all, the int'l ones have extra to fit in all these different languages. They're cool because you can go in and erase the languages you don't need and have plenty of ROM for app's. Alas, the US versions are pretty barebones, unless you completely don't use BT or other ROM apps. If you lose those, you can gain a MB or so.
